About this listen
Rebecca Finch is a highly successful romantic novelist who has fallen out of love with love. Things look bad. The High Princess of Romance is having a crisis of Faith.
On Mount Olympus, things aren't any easier. Aphrodite's is fretting because divorce is almost as popular as marriage. So with even her favourite earth-bound acolyte, Rebecca Finch, showing signs of disillusionment, Aphrodite resolves to take drastic action.

Critic reviews
"Pure romantic comedy, but underlying it is same acerbity that made Shooting Butterflies such an unexpected joy... witty, touching and perceptive....Her touch is a light but acute, her tone easy but flecked with real, black sharpness." (Observer)
